General Info
In Block
f63f3e7e666c3829acf04235447253414f3a5f705660f8b0301f9fbb8a489141
In block height
Total Input
3243442.98979307 RDD
Total Output
3244946.7145476 RDD
Transaction Details
Fee
0 RDD
mined Wed, 27 Dec 2023 18:43:43 UTC
From
3243442.98979307 RDD